You do not need legal representation to make a financial services claim. You can complain yourself at no cost and under FCA rules, the financial services provider must provide a response. If you feel this is unsatisfactory, you can complain to the statutory redress bodies, the FOS and FSCS who can award you compensation. This is a free service.
